Buying Guide for Window Air Conditioners
BTU Capacity and Room Size
Selecting the correct BTU capacity is crucial for efficient cooling and energy savings. Under-sized units struggle to cool effectively and run constantly, while oversized units cycle on and off frequently, creating humidity problems and inefficient operation.
- 5,000 BTU: 100-150 square feet (small bedrooms, offices)
- 6,000 BTU: 150-250 square feet (medium bedrooms, studios)
- 8,000 BTU: 250-350 square feet (large rooms, living areas)
- 10,000+ BTU: 350+ square feet (large living rooms, open concepts)
Energy Efficiency Considerations
Energy Star certification indicates units meet strict efficiency guidelines, potentially reducing cooling costs by 10-15% compared to standard models. Look for high CEER (Combined Energy Efficiency Ratio) ratings, which measure cooling output per energy unit consumed.
Programmable thermostats and timer functions help optimize energy usage by allowing pre-scheduled operation during peak cooling hours. Sleep mode reduces fan speed and gradually adjusts temperature for comfortable nighttime cooling with lower energy consumption.
Noise Levels and Placement
Decibel ratings indicate operational noise levels, with 52-55 dB considered quiet for bedroom use. Units with variable fan speeds allow noise reduction during nighttime hours while maintaining adequate cooling during peak demand periods.
Window placement affects both cooling efficiency and noise perception. Units installed in bedrooms should prioritize quiet operation, while living area installations can accommodate slightly louder models with higher cooling capacity.
Installation and Maintenance Requirements
Most window air conditioners include installation kits with mounting brackets, side panels, and weatherstripping. Verify window size compatibility and weight limits before purchase, as larger units may require additional support structures.
Washable filters reduce ongoing maintenance costs and improve air quality. Units with filter alerts remind users when cleaning is necessary, maintaining optimal airflow and efficiency. Regular filter maintenance extends unit lifespan and prevents decreased cooling performance.
Smart Features and Controls
Wi-Fi connectivity enables remote operation through smartphone apps, allowing temperature adjustments and scheduling from anywhere. Voice control compatibility with Alexa or Google Home provides hands-free operation convenience.
Electronic controls offer precise temperature settings and multiple operational modes, while mechanical controls provide reliable operation with fewer potential failure points. Consider your preference for advanced features versus simple, dependable operation when making your selection.
